Output d90dcf65cffe634ed089514b1ccdf51a57cc584b8ca58a4a03bc0d4393872d8b:72

value
10900547
script pubkey
OP_0 OP_PUSHBYTES_20 b4d6c68e8cd3bd06f9b7232737720c0584ecb339
address
bc1qkntvdr5v6w7sd7dhyvnnwusvqkzweveeq8aml6
transaction
d90dcf65cffe634ed089514b1ccdf51a57cc584b8ca58a4a03bc0d4393872d8b
confirmations
188494
spent
true